Transaction 2999ce80fcef025b1f5c104bb1e85a089f96332ddc13b5d3831ca8dbafcf5e72

1 Input
2 Outputs
  • 2999ce80fcef025b1f5c104bb1e85a089f96332ddc13b5d3831ca8dbafcf5e72:0
  • value  2355116
    address  3JaLdnDhTDmZTg4937YA8VUBeuJfHCXRua
  • 2999ce80fcef025b1f5c104bb1e85a089f96332ddc13b5d3831ca8dbafcf5e72:1
  • value  62181266
    address  bc1qg83pyg47edqd4jdu6vyjjcq3dahv68hpnwzpmvj53y44sv9vc75qdf2vpp